Those fanpages are usually stuffed with nonsense though; beyond reasonable doubt there's literally zero information that's even plausible to have come from 3DRealms themselves. It's only rumors.
3DRealms has always been independent enough to still cover salaries with lots of zeroes involved. Why financial problems right now? A huge BBQ and party? No problem. Even a party to celebrate DNF's upcoming release was already planned or perhaps that BBQ was exactly that?
Anyways, 3DRealms already sold the license to publish many many years ago, this is a well known fact, said by 3DRealms themselves. They obviously still got the IP and don't intend to ever sell that.
But Take-Two, who was going to publish DNF, is going to sue Apogee for all this, apparently they're not to happy about their 12 million dollar investment (for publishing only, no financial contract) disappearing in thin air.
I think it's obvious Apogee has been definitely thinking about either yet another restart of DNF or simply a continuation of development of 'their' product; otherwise they really really would have sold the IP for that title a very long time ago.
I don't think releasing DNF is their top priority anyways, I think they still want to release 'when it's done' like they've always said.
Anyways, I am quite sure it's not a joke, even though the websites are back online. Of course, I'd be glad if I turn out to be wrong about that as I don't know either. It would be crazy though if it turns out to be a marketing thing.
